Nepali society is undergoing a cultural shift. While arranged marriages were once the norm, modern Nepalis—especially in urban centers like Kathmandu and Pokhara—are increasingly exploring and casual dating. This doesn't mean they've abandoned core values like family respect, honesty, and loyalty. Instead, many now seek a balance, using technology to find partners who share their cultural background and personal aspirations.
